I ran a keto diet for 2 months and those were 2 of the least enjoyable months of my life; keto makes your sweat smell weird, energy feels totally different, and the lack of satiety from the absence of carbs really starts to mess with your head after a while. Some folks can do it without issue, and I am definitely not one of them.

And yeah, homeopathic remedies are sold to make money off of misconception, that doesn't mean that misconceptions can't be useful. Learning to work with your own placebo effect can be a worthwhile undertaking, but it requires some rather strange thinking so I can understand why many would think this unusual. I knew Airborne was and is bullshit insofar as it's ingredients are concerned, but when I took it, I felt slightly better. The same holds true for a multivitamin. Many multi's are provably useless in a direct sense, with many of the standard pills passing through digestion in whole form and very little of the vitamins being utilized. However, I take mine religiously, and I haven't been sick or really felt that bad physically for a long while. Is it the multi? Probably not. But, if I can afford it and my health continues positively, why not?

I've been doing cyclical keto and works ok for me for losing weight. Basically you do 2-3 day keto runs, then u have a post workout pizza/ice cream and then keep going for 2-3 days, repeat. Pure keto sucks though.
